当前位置: 首页 > wzjs >正文

免费做网站软件视频字体图标网站

免费做网站软件视频,字体图标网站,做饮食网站怎么样,asp动态链接生成网站地图PostgreSQL 全球开发组于 2025 年 5 月 8 日发布了第一个 PostgreSQL 18 Beta 版本,现已开放下载。虽然细节可能会有所改变,但是该版本包含了 PostgreSQL 18 最终正式版中所有新功能的预览。 以下是 PostgreSQL 18 引入的部分关键功能亮点。 性能优化 …

PostgreSQL 全球开发组于 2025 年 5 月 8 日发布了第一个 PostgreSQL 18 Beta 版本,现已开放下载。虽然细节可能会有所改变,但是该版本包含了 PostgreSQL 18 最终正式版中所有新功能的预览。

以下是 PostgreSQL 18 引入的部分关键功能亮点。

性能优化

  • 异步 I/O(AIO),通过全新的异步 I/O 子系统提升 I/O 吞吐量并隐藏延迟。Linux 系统可使用 io_uring,其他平台则提供基于“工作线程”的通用实现。当前支持顺序扫描、位图堆扫描和 VACUUM 操作的异步文件读取,测试显示性能提升达 2-3 倍。
  • 查询优化,PostgreSQL 18 支持多列 B-Tree 索引 Skip Scan 优化,可以加速缺少前缀列“=”条件的查询;新版本还改进了对 WHERE 子句中 OR 或 IN (…) 条件的索引利用,提升查询性能;hash join 整体性能提升,merge join 支持增量排序。
  • 并行索引构建,支持 GIN 索引的并行构建,通常用于 JSON 和全文搜索场景。
  • 分区表与锁定优化,改进了分区表查询的修剪效率及连接支持,以及多表查询时的锁定开销,提升高并发场景性能。
  • 文本处理优化,提升了文本数据的处理性能,包括 upper/lower 函数性能提升以及一个新的内置排序规则 PG_UNICODE_FAST。

版本升级

  • 优化器统计信息保留,主版本升级后(例如 PostgreSQL 17 升级到 PostgreSQL 18),自动保留统计信息,无需手动执行 ANALYZE,缩短性能恢复时间。
  • pg_upgrade 工具增强,支持并行检查(通过 --jobs 参数),加速包含大量表或序列的版本升级;新增 --swap 标志,通过交换目录而非复制或链接文件加速升级流程。

开发体验

  • 虚拟生成列,PostgreSQL 18 版本的生成列(Generated Columns)默认支持“virtual”模式,只在执行查询时动态计算字段值,无需占用存储;另外,存储式生成列可以支持逻辑复制。
  • RETURNING 子句扩展,INSERT、UPDATE、DELETE 和 MERGE 命令的 RETURNING 子句支持同时访问旧值(OLD)和新值(NEW)。
  • UUIDv7,新增 uuidv7() 函数生成时间戳有序的 UUID,优化缓存策略;同时新增 uuidv4() 作为 gen_rand_uuid 的别名。
  • 模式匹配增强,支持对非确定性排序规则的文本进行 LIKE 匹配,新增 CASEFOLD 函数用于大小写不敏感的匹配。
  • 约束增强,主键和唯一约束支持“无重叠”的时间范围约束(WITHOUT OVERLAPS),外键支持 PERIOD 子句。

安全特性

  • OAuth 认证,支持通过扩展实现 OAuth 2.0 认证机制。
  • FIPS 模式与 TLS 1.3,新增 FIPS 模式验证与强制功能;支持通过 ssl_tls13_ciphers 配置 TLS 1.3 加密套件。
  • SCRAM 默认认证,PostgreSQL 18 开始弃用 md5 密码认证,全面转向 SCRAM,未来版本将彻底移除 md5 认证;postgres_fdw 和 dblink 支持 SCRAM 透传认证访问远程 PostgreSQL 实例。

可观测性

  • EXPLAIN 增强,EXPLAIN ANALYZE 自动显示缓冲区访问次数及索引查找次数;EXPLAIN ANALYZE VERBOSE 新增 CPU、WAL 及平均读取统计信息。
  • 统计视图扩展,pg_stat_all_tables 新增表级 VACUUM 和分析耗时统计;新增连接级 I/O 和 WAL 使用统计;逻辑复制冲突信息记录至日志及 pg_stat_subscription_stats 视图。

其他亮点

  • 默认启用数据校验和,PostgreSQL 18 开始的新集群默认启用数据校验和功能,可通过 initdb --no-data-checksums 禁用。
  • 约束功能增强,外键和检查约束支持 NOT ENFORCED 以及 ENFORCED 属性;NOT NULL 约束支持自定义名称,更加符合 SQL 标准; 同时还支持 NOT VALID 和 NO INHERIT 子句,与继承功能一致。
  • pg_createsubscriber,新增 --all 标志,支持一键为实例中所有数据库创建逻辑副本。
  • 外部表定义,新增 CREATE FOREIGN TABLE … LIKE 命令,可以基于本地表定义创建外部表。
  • PostgreSQL 协议,推出新版 PostgreSQL 3.2 版本总线协议,libpq 仍然使用 3.0 协议,客户端驱动增加了新协议支持。

更多特性

除了以上内容,PostgreSQL 18 还增加了大量的新功能和改进,完整的新特性列表可以参考官方的发行说明:

https://www.postgresql.org/docs/18/release-18.html

PostgreSQL 18 正式版计划将于 2025 年 9 月左右发布。


文章转载自:

http://ROyzIKuh.tyjnr.cn
http://AmTQfaBY.tyjnr.cn
http://h0nLJuem.tyjnr.cn
http://KWQkPNd0.tyjnr.cn
http://IpulSAtP.tyjnr.cn
http://xVlQjt4T.tyjnr.cn
http://6nKYQirK.tyjnr.cn
http://G9XdWoKZ.tyjnr.cn
http://3JrZh4JP.tyjnr.cn
http://9emV6UsS.tyjnr.cn
http://Goo0IX7L.tyjnr.cn
http://HrggYi0j.tyjnr.cn
http://SCcmscZm.tyjnr.cn
http://oOrmomNi.tyjnr.cn
http://MXl8Jfqo.tyjnr.cn
http://HDGCnSxq.tyjnr.cn
http://gAlHMTsJ.tyjnr.cn
http://AylXF124.tyjnr.cn
http://spbCa6ay.tyjnr.cn
http://XCmNFyOo.tyjnr.cn
http://ZtB6xeVE.tyjnr.cn
http://0k2obYg4.tyjnr.cn
http://fAKNAIv3.tyjnr.cn
http://t8aikxCA.tyjnr.cn
http://HJlWHuhs.tyjnr.cn
http://fE9asGRs.tyjnr.cn
http://2kKmf5s9.tyjnr.cn
http://8LefnOgB.tyjnr.cn
http://p5B8Dgyk.tyjnr.cn
http://sA4bPyao.tyjnr.cn
http://www.dtcms.com/wzjs/767192.html

相关文章:

  • 做网站要学多久云系统wordpress
  • 支付功能网站建设wordpress 本机模拟
  • 申请网站建设经费求网站懂的说下开车
  • wordpress构建企业网站四川建设厅官网查询官网
  • 网站建设制作 南京公司网站转移
  • 建设网站公司怎么分工展示型网站可以优化吗
  • 佛山网站建设正规公司开源网站有哪些
  • 沈阳酒店企业网站制作电子商务网站网络安全设计方案
  • 广州网站建设技术方案网站开发与维护工资
  • w3c标准网站深圳公司官网制作
  • 网站如何进行备案济南网站设计建设公司
  • 郧阳网站建设河南建设厅证件查询平台
  • 网站建设验收单模板四合一小说网站搭建教程
  • 上饶网站seo百度搜索seo怎么做
  • 建站公司人员配置排名前十的大学
  • 金堂县建设局网站要写网站建设方案
  • n怎样建立自己的网站有没有可以发布需求的网站
  • 公司网站开发款记什么科目查看网站访问量
  • html5 电商网站布局建设手机银行app下载
  • 焦作建设网站的公司yc011 wordpress主题
  • 北京科技网站制作做网站还能赚钱吗
  • 定制一个企业网站多少钱网站建设易尔通
  • 淘宝返利网站建设wordpress 徽标
  • 博客百度网盘优化
  • 网站评论怎么做的营销技巧在线完整免费观看
  • 公司的网站备案要怎么制作网站
  • 做株洲网站需要多少钱男女做暖暖插孔网站
  • 长沙网站排名系统做黑网站赚钱
  • wordpress插件使用教程企业关键词排名优化公司
  • 建造师免费自学网站两学一做专栏网站